What are the requirements for refractory brick masonry

Nowadays, refractory bricks are widely used in industrial kilns, and their excellent performance is widely used in various kiln parts. However, due to their different functions from other materials, there are also requirements for masonry. So, let's briefly understand the requirements for masonry of refractory bricks.

1. Refractory brick arches and arches must be symmetrically built from both sides of the arch feet towards the center. During construction, the large and small ends of the arch bricks cannot be inverted; Lock bricks should be inserted from the side into the arch. If it is not possible to insert them from the side at the end of the quick lock brick, 1-2 bricks on one side of the lock mouth can be processed first to make the upper and lower dimensions of the lock mouth equal. Then, lock bricks that match the size of the lock mouth should be inserted from above and both sides should be filled with steel plates; The dismantling of the arch must be carried out only after all the locking bricks have been tightened, the trench excavation and masonry at the arch foot have been completed, and the nuts of the skeleton hook have been tightened.

2. For the joints of refractory bricks that are not tightly built, thin steel plates should be inserted to plug them tightly. Especially for rotatable furnaces, inspection should be carried out every 1/4 turn, and the above measures should be taken to remedy the situation.

3. The position of expansion joints should be reserved for refractory brick masonry, avoiding the stress parts, furnace skeleton, and holes in the masonry. The expansion joints of the inner and outer layers of the masonry should not be interconnected, and the upper and lower layers should be staggered from each other.

4. The long edge of the non curved furnace bottom and upper layer of the channel bottom should be perpendicular to or at an angle to the flow direction of the furnace charge, metal, slag, or gas.

5. The circular furnace wall should be built with refractory bricks according to the centerline. When the centerline error and diameter error of the furnace shell meet the requirements of the furnace shape, the furnace shell can be used as the guide surface for masonry.

6. The circular furnace wall cannot have three layers or three ring double seams, and the double seams of the upper and lower layers and adjacent two rings cannot be in the same location.
